How much does custom AI software cost in Australia?
Based on what we charge and what we see across the market: a custom AI-powered platform built for an Australian business typically costs between $35,000 and $75,000 AUD and takes 10 to 16 weeks, while integrating AI into your existing operations, connecting the systems you already have and automating the workflows between them, typically runs between $8,000 and $25,000 AUD over 4 to 8 weeks. In this article I want to explain what drives a project toward one end of those ranges or the other, and how to work out whether the investment stacks up for your business.
Why the quoted ranges across the market are so confusing
If you have researched this question already, you will have found numbers everywhere from $3,000 to $500,000, which is about as useful as being told a vehicle costs somewhere between a skateboard and a super yacht. The reason for the spread is that "custom AI software" covers genuinely different categories of work. A chatbot trained on your website content is a small project. A platform that reads incoming documents, makes decisions about them, updates your systems and hands exceptions to a human is a medium one. A custom-trained machine learning model for a specialised industrial application is a large one. Most of the confusing quotes you will find online are describing different categories without saying so.
For the kind of work most established small and mid-sized businesses actually need, which is automating the operational workflows that currently consume staff time, the realistic range in Australia right now is roughly $8,000 at the simple end to $75,000 or more for a full platform. That is the range the rest of this article is about.
What pushes a project toward the top or bottom of the range
Three things matter far more than anything else. The first is how many systems the AI needs to connect to, because every additional system, your job management tool, your accounting software, your CRM, adds integration work, and older or more unusual software adds more than newer, well-documented platforms. The second is how much judgment the AI needs to exercise. Moving data from a form into a database is simple. Reading an architectural drawing, interpreting it, and populating forty fields with confidence scores is not, and the difference shows up in the price. The third is the state of your existing processes. Not your data, which matters less than most people think, but whether anyone in your business can actually describe how the process works today, including the exceptions. Projects where the process lives entirely in one person's head take longer to scope, and scoping time is real cost.
What the return actually looks like
The only sensible way to evaluate any of these numbers is against what the problem is currently costing you. One of our clients, a building compliance consultancy, was spending 90 minutes of manual data entry per job across 15 jobs a day. We built a platform that reads the building plans and pre-populates their job system, taking each job from 90 minutes to 3 minutes. The build cost $75,000, at the top of our range, and the forecast bottom-line improvement in the first year was $750,000. A 10x return, calculated conservatively from their own numbers.
That ratio is unusual, but the shape of the calculation is not. If a process is consuming two hours of someone's day at a fully loaded cost of $45 an hour, that is around $22,000 a year, every year, for as long as you leave it in place. Against that recurring cost, a one-off build in the $8,000 to $25,000 range pays for itself quickly, which is why the most useful first step is not getting quotes but working out what your current manual processes actually cost. What ongoing costs to expect
Custom AI software has two ongoing costs worth budgeting for properly. The first is AI usage itself, since the models that power these systems are metered, like electricity. For a typical workflow automation processing hundreds of documents a month, this usually lands in the tens to low hundreds of dollars per month, and it is calculable in advance rather than a surprise. The second is maintenance and refinement, because your business rules change and the system should change with them. A reasonable budget across the market is 15 to 20 percent of the build cost annually, though for smaller focused builds it is often less.
Questions we get asked
Is it cheaper to use offshore developers? The hourly rates are lower, but for AI work specifically, where the value is in understanding your operations rather than writing the most code, the total cost difference is usually smaller than the rate difference suggests, and the rework risk is higher.
Can I start smaller than $8,000? Sometimes. If the goal is to test whether AI can handle one specific task before committing to a build, a scoped discovery engagement is the right first step.
